Onboarding Analyst - 2026 US Graduate Program
Marex is a dynamic capital markets firm that offers a two-year Graduate Program for recent graduates. The Onboarding Analyst plays a key role in ensuring the smooth and compliant integration of new clients and investors into the company’s financial ecosystem, executing onboarding processes that meet regulatory standards while delivering a positive client experience.

Responsibilities
Substantiate and reconcile relevant balance sheet accounts, ensuring Group revenue and associated costs are accurately reflected
Collect, review, and validate client documentation to ensure compliance with KYC and AML regulations
Conduct due diligence and risk assessments on new clients and counterparties
Coordinate with internal teams (e.g., Legal, Compliance, Sales, Operations) to facilitate timely and accurate onboarding
Monitor regulatory changes and assist in updating onboarding procedures and documentation accordingly
Maintain accurate records of onboarding activities and ensure data integrity across systems
Respond to client inquiries related to onboarding requirements and provide guidance throughout the process
Support continuous improvement initiatives to streamline onboarding workflows and enhance client experience
Stay informed on financial standards and industry best practices
Ensuring compliance with the company’s regulatory requirements under the SEC, FINRA, NFA, CFTC and other applicable exchanges and regulatory bodies
